Rolling Your Own Servers in Python

Most of the Internet modules we looked at in the last few chapters deal with client-side interfaces such as FTP and Post Office Protocol (POP), or special server-side protocols such as CGI that hide the underlying server itself. If you want to build servers in Python by hand, you can do so either manually or by using higher-level tools.

Standard Library Socket Servers

We explored the sort of code needed to build servers manually in Chapter 13. Python programs typically implement servers either by using raw socket calls with threads, forks, or selects to handle clients in parallel, or by using the standard library SocketServer module. As we learned earlier, this module supports TCP and UDP sockets, in threading and forking flavors; you provide a class method invoked to communicate with clients.

Whether clients are handled manually or with Python classes, to serve requests made in terms of higher-level protocols such as FTP, the Network News Transfer Protocol (NNTP), and HTTP, you must listen on the protocol’s port and add appropriate code to handle the protocol’s message conventions. If you go this route, the client-side protocol modules in Python’s standard library can help you understand the message conventions used.
